Fetch is great. Fetch with a soundtrack is better. The Chuckit! Whistler Ball is built with four sound holes that produce a genuine whistle as it soars through the air off a throw or a launcher — giving your dog an extra sensory cue to track and chase, not just a ball to watch.
Made from durable, easy-to-clean natural rubber, the Whistler delivers Chuckit!'s signature high bounce for longer, more dynamic fetch sessions, while staying gentle on your dog's mouth and gums during pickup. This Medium size is sized for dogs roughly 9–27kg and is designed to pair with a Medium Chuckit! Launcher, letting you send it further and get that whistle really singing (a gentle underarm toss won't trigger much sound — it's built for the launcher).
Note that the Whistler is a land toy — it's not designed to float, so keep water play for one of Chuckit!'s buoyant balls instead. As with any fetch toy, it's not intended as a chew toy, so supervised play is recommended to keep your dog safe and the ball whistling for longer.

Quick Specs
| Spec | Detail |
|---|---|
| Size | Medium — 6.35cm diameter |
| Suitable for | Dogs approx. 9–27kg |
| Material | Durable natural rubber |
| Sound | Whistles via 4 sound holes when launched |
| Buoyancy | Not designed to float (land use only) |
| Launcher compatibility | Chuckit! Medium Ball Launcher |
| Chew-safe | No — fetch toy, not a chew toy |
